如何检测网格视图c#中是否没有选中的行?

时间:2013-11-16 13:40:08

标签: c# linq datagridview

如何检测c#中的网格视图中是否没有选择行,这样我就可以显示一条消息,告知没有选择任何行?

2 个答案:

答案 0 :(得分:1)

您可以使用SelectedRows属性获取SelectedRowsDataGridView的计数

 if(dataGridView1.SelectedRows.Count==0)
                MessageBox.Show("No Rows Selected!");

答案 1 :(得分:0)

这将满足您的需求。

 if(gridView.SelectedIndex == -1) {}

如果您需要访问该行本身,可以按如下方式组合搜索和检索。

 if(gridView.SelectedValue !=null) {}